Mine at pu9 is a fast, decision-driven crash game built on a classic concept: a hidden grid of tiles conceals a mix of diamonds and bombs. At the start of each round you place your bet, choose how many mines to hide in the grid, and then start flipping tiles one at a time. Every diamond you uncover safely increases your live multiplier. The tension builds with each tap — and you decide exactly when to cash out before a bomb ends the round.
Unlike slot machines where every spin is entirely passive, Mine demands real decisions every few seconds — how many mines do you set? Do you go for one more tile or cash out now? At pu9, the Mine game grid is a 5x5 layout — 25 tiles in total. You choose between 1 and 24 mines before flipping, which directly controls the risk-reward balance. Fewer mines means lower multipliers that climb slowly and safely. More mines cranks the multiplier up dramatically but leaves very few safe tiles on the board. The math is transparent: pu9 displays your current multiplier and potential payout in real time so you always know exactly what a cash-out is worth at this moment.
pu9 runs Mine on a provably fair RNG system that is independently audited. This means neither the platform nor any third party can influence where the mines land — every grid layout is generated at the start of the round and locked before you flip your first tile. The seed used to generate the grid can be verified after each round, giving Bangladesh players the same transparency they would expect from a regulated international platform.

Choose Your Risk Level
Mine at pu9 scales from beginner-safe to ultra-high-risk. Here is how each risk tier plays out.
Low-risk Mine (1–3 mines) is ideal for new pu9 players learning the game — multipliers grow steadily and you have many safe tiles to flip before a mine is likely. Medium risk is the sweet spot for most experienced Bangladesh players: a 5-mine grid on a 25-tile board still leaves 20 safe tiles but the multiplier climbs noticeably faster. High risk (10+ mines) is for players who enjoy short, explosive sessions — the board fills with danger but a single successful run of four or five tiles can return a 20x or higher multiplier.
